The Best Advice to Care For and Raise Your Parrot
With The Parrot: An Owner?s Guide to a Happy Healthy Pet you will discover easy ways to provide the very best in care and training for your bird. An avian expert offers straightforward advice so that you can create a thriving relationship with your new family member.
The Parrot offers:
- Completely up-to-date resources, including top Web sites of interest to bird owners
- Information on choosing the best parrot for your lifestyle
- Ways to mentally stimulate and entertain your quizzical pet bird
- Advice on the best nutrition to keep your parrot healthy and long-lived
- Answers to your most pressing bird-behavior questions
- Full-color photographs of parrots in a variety of settings

About the Author
Arthur Freud has been a renowned presence in the world of aviculture since 1974. He is the former publisher of American Caged-Bird magazine and has written extensively on bird-related subjects.
